Description

FIG. 1 is a rear perspective view of a hair stylizing device in the open configuration, showing my new design;

FIG. 2 is a rear perspective view thereof in the closed configuration;

FIG. 3 is a side elevational view thereof in the closed configuration, with the opposite side being identical to that shown;

FIG. 4 is a side elevational view thereof in the open configuration, with the opposite side being identical to that shown;

FIG. 5 is a top plan view thereof, with the bottom side being identical to that shown;

FIG. 6 is a front elevational view thereof in the closed configuration;

FIG. 7 is a rear elevational view thereof in the closed configuration; and,

FIG. 8 is a front elevational view thereof in the open configuration.

The broken line showing the electrical power supply cord is for illustrative purposes only and forms no part of the claimed design.

Claims

The ornamental design for a hair stylizing device, as shown and described.
